A Community Responds
Collaborative Effort to Address Childcare Crisis in Emmet County
Access to high quality, affordable childcare is an essential element of a thriving community. In Michigan, there is only one childcare space for every four children under the age of 12. This situation is often even more challenging in Northern Michigan and rural areas, like Emmet County, where more than one third of families pay more than $1,000/month for childcare. The impact of this undersupply is felt throughout the community and North Central Michigan College is responding to this systemic issue. It launched the first phase of its three-phased Child Care Initiative in 2022, pulling together multi-sector partners to develop a community-centered plan for a sustainable and viable local child care system.
